The World Federation for Coral Reef Conservation (WFCRC) is a 501 (c) (3) international group of volunteer earth scientist, marine biologists, knowledge workers and concerned citizens full engaged in coral reef and coastal conservation efforts for unreserved developing island nations around the world. Job Description
Job Purpose:
Enhance and develop web site by providing executive management support.
We are looking for a Front-End Web Developer who is motivated to combine the art of design with the art of programming. Responsibilities will include wire frames to actual code that will produce visual elements of the application. You will bridge the gap between graphical design and technical implementation, taking an active role on both sides and defining how the application looks as well as how it works. Experience in word press is necessary to keep our sites current.
Responsibilities
- Develop new user-facing features
- Build reusable code and libraries for future use
- Ensure the technical feasibility of user interface and designs
- Optimize application for maximum speed and scalability
- Assure that all user input is validated before submitting to back-end
- Collaborate with other team members and stakeholders
- Develop custom information feeds
Skills And Qualifications
- Professionalism and commitment to follow through on projects
- Proficient understanding of web markup, including HTML5, CSS3, Word Press
- Basic understanding of server-side CSS pre-processing platforms, such as LESS and SASS
- Proficient understanding of client-side scripting and JavaScript frameworks, including jQuery
- Good understanding of advanced JavaScript libraries and frameworks.
- Good understanding of asynchronous request handling, partial page updates, and AJAXBasic knowledge of image authoring tools, to be able to crop, resize, or perform small adjustments on an image. Familiarity with tools such as as Gimp or Photoshop is a plus..
- Proficient understanding of cross-browser compatibility issues and ways to work around them.
- Good understanding of SEO principles and ensuring that application will adhere to them.

Mission Statement
The mission of The World Federation for Coral Reef Conservation is to advance the understanding, use and conservation of coral reefs through an integrated program of excellence in data gathering/sharing, education, and outreach built upon active and long term partnerships with divers, conservationist, the science community and local island governments and stakeholders. The broad objectives are aimed at developing this effort and sustaining the same effort for long term. These objectives are used to set goals that are attainable based on the following criteria.
All activities must satisfy three major criteria:
1. Be based on a strong rationale,
2. Demonstrate scientific merit as determined by national experts in the field, and
3. Produce application-oriented results that are clearly useful in industry, management and/or science.
Description
The World Federation for Coral Reef Conservation core values are of excellence, relevance, integrity, teamwork, and accountability.
In developing and sustaining our priorities, we have sought the advice of experts in the fieldand stakeholders that represent the broad community of individuals and organizations with marine interest. Their regular and frequent input helps us sustain a dynamic and flexible view of issues through the eyes of our various coastal constituencies.
Based upon this input, The World Federation for Coral Reef Conservation is the model for data and information sharing, research, education, and outreach for our conservation programs. These priority areas cross-cut a number of concerns both environmentally and for conservation efforts.
